Usk cricketer and Old Monmothian Tony Kear completed a hat-trick of London Marathons last weekend, raising a further £2,448.77 for St Anne's Hospice.In three years, he has raised more than £10,000, including gift aid, for the Newport-based charity.This year Tony managed this year to complete the course in four hours and 25 minutes, a personal best despite the heat and humidity – and beating last year by 15 minutes."The Virgin London Marathon is quite unique with an incredible build up and atmosphere on the day, especially with the remarkable support from the spectators and fellow runners," said Tony."Having to get a bus to the start line at Greenwich from the hotel at 6.15am for a 9.45am start was a bit of a shock and the heat and humidity on the day made it more challenging but equally rewarding."
